Light scattering from fibers: a closer look with a new twist
Abstract:
Scattering from an apparently perfect fiber, placed perpendicular to a laser beam, produces an out of plane scattering pattern containing an internal structure not predicted by simple fiber scattering theory. A photographic study of light scattered from twisted fibers shows that the effect is due to periodic disturbances along the fiber axis that act as coherent scattering centers.
